Cost of memory care in Pierce, CO

The average cost of senior living in Pierce is $5,247 per month. Cheaper nearby regions include Grover, CO with an average of $4,461 per month.

Senior living costs in Pierce vs. state and national costs

Cost comparison table showing community type costs by location. This table contains 3 rows of data across 4 columns.
Column communityType: Community type
Column destination: Pierce, CO
Column state: Colorado
Column national: U.S.
Community typePierce, COColoradoU.S.
Memory Care$5,247/mo$5,145/mo$4,794/mo
Assisted Living$5,117/mo$5,050/mo$4,557/mo
Independent Living$4,504/mo$4,182/mo$4,016/mo

Memory care cost trends in Pierce, CO

The table below shows how monthly memory care costs in Pierce have changed in the last two years and how those changes compare with state and national trends. The figures represent averages of actual costs paid by seniors who moved into A Place for Mom partner communities in 2023 and 2024.

Cost comparison table showing 2023 and 2024 median costs by location. This table contains 3 rows of data across 4 columns.
Column location: Location
Column cost2024: 2024 average cost
Column cost2023: 2023 average cost
Column percentChange: Percent change
Location2024 average cost2023 average costPercent change
Pierce, CO$6,906/mo$6,563/mo+5.2%
Colorado$7,031/mo$6,401/mo+9.8%
National$6,490/mo$6,152/mo+5.5%
